BSV区块链游戏源码开发指南bsv区块链游戏源码
本文目录导读:
随着区块链技术的快速发展,区块链游戏逐渐成为娱乐、投资和金融领域的重要组成部分,BSV(并行链)作为一项高性能区块链平台,为区块链游戏的开发提供了强大的技术支持,本文将详细介绍BSV区块链游戏源码的开发流程、技术特点以及应用场景,帮助读者更好地理解和应用BSV技术。
区块链游戏是一种结合了区块链技术和游戏元素的新型娱乐形式,通过区块链技术,游戏可以实现去中心化、透明化和不可篡改的特性,从而提升游戏的公平性和安全性,BSV作为一项高性能区块链平台,其技术特点使其成为区块链游戏开发的理想选择,本文将从BSV的技术特点、开发流程以及应用场景三个方面,全面解析BSV区块链游戏源码的开发。
BSV区块链游戏源码的技术特点
-
高性能与低延迟
BSV以其极高的交易速度和低延迟著称,其共识机制采用两阶段共识(BPoS)算法,能够有效提高网络的交易速度,使其成为区块链游戏的理想底层协议,BSV的tx/s(每秒交易量)和tx费(每笔交易费用)均处于行业领先水平,能够满足高负载游戏的需求。 -
可扩展性
BSV通过分片技术实现了网络的可扩展性,分片技术将网络划分为多个独立的片,每个片处理一部分数据,从而提高网络的处理能力和吞吐量,这对于区块链游戏的高并发场景非常有用。 -
智能合约支持
BSV内置了智能合约功能,能够自动执行复杂的逻辑操作,这对于区块链游戏中的自动交易、余额管理等功能非常有用,开发者可以利用智能合约简化游戏的逻辑实现。 -
去中心化与安全性
BSV采用了先进的安全性措施,包括多签名钱包、tx签名验证等,确保交易的安全性,BSV支持多种共识机制,能够根据游戏的需求选择合适的共识算法。
BSV区块链游戏源码的开发流程
-
项目搭建
需要搭建BSV的开发环境,这包括安装Node.js、配置开发工具链、下载BSV的源码等,开发者可以根据自己的需求选择合适的版本。 -
脚本编写
在BSV上开发区块链游戏需要编写Solidity脚本,Solidity是一种专门为BSV设计的脚本语言,支持智能合约的编写,开发者需要根据游戏的功能需求编写脚本,定义代币、tx、账户等。 -
tx编写与部署
编写完脚本后,需要生成tx并部署到BSV网络中,这包括tx的签名、tx的提交以及tx的确认等步骤,BSV的智能合约功能能够自动处理tx的验证和部署,简化了开发流程。 -
游戏功能实现
在BSV网络上实现游戏的各种功能,如角色创建、任务分配、资源获取等,开发者可以利用BSV的tx功能实现游戏的交易逻辑,利用智能合约实现游戏的自动管理。 -
测试与优化
在开发过程中,需要对代码进行充分的测试,确保tx的正确性、tx的安全性以及游戏功能的正常运行,还需要对tx的性能进行优化,提高网络的处理能力和吞吐量。
BSV区块链游戏的应用场景
-
NFT游戏
NFT游戏是区块链游戏的一种重要形式,通过BSV的智能合约功能,可以实现NFT的发行、交易和展示,开发者可以利用BSV的tx功能,为NFT游戏提供丰富的功能,如虚拟资产的交易、展示和展示。 -
虚拟资产交易
BSV可以作为底层区块链平台,支持虚拟资产的交易,开发者可以利用BSV的tx功能,为虚拟资产交易所提供高性能、低延迟的交易服务。 -
游戏化平台
通过BSV的智能合约功能,可以构建一个去中心化的游戏化平台,平台可以支持多种游戏功能,如角色扮演、任务完成、资源获取等,平台还可以通过BSV的tx功能实现游戏内的交易和展示。
随着区块链技术的不断发展,BSV区块链游戏源码的应用场景将更加广泛,随着BSV技术的不断优化和升级,区块链游戏将更加智能化、便捷化和娱乐化,开发者可以利用BSV的技术优势,开发出更多创新的区块链游戏,为区块链技术的应用带来更多的可能性。
BSV区块链游戏源码的开发为区块链游戏的未来发展提供了强有力的技术支持,通过BSV的高性能、可扩展性和智能合约功能,开发者可以轻松构建出功能丰富、体验良好的区块链游戏,随着BSV技术的不断进步,区块链游戏将更加繁荣,为娱乐、投资和金融等领域带来更多的价值。
BSV区块链游戏源码开发指南bsv区块链游戏源码,
发表评论